President Obama named Christa Duthie-Fox with more than 100 other science, math, and engineering teachers and mentors as recipients of two prestigious Presidential Awards for Excellence. The educators received their awards at a White House ceremony.
'There is no higher calling than furthering the educational advancement of our nation’s young people and encouraging and inspiring our next generation of leaders," President Obama said. "These awards represent a heartfelt salute of appreciation to a remarkable group of individuals who have devoted their lives and careers to helping others and in doing so have helped us all."
